Configuring Call Preferences
All users can set auto answer options for calls and specify the maximum number of entries to appear in the Redial list. 
Refer to “Placing a Call” on page 56 for more information.
Administrators can configure the maximum call time and bandwidth in Administrator Preferences : Calls
Managing Bandwidth
You can specify the maximum bandwidth that an outgoing or incoming call uses by setting the Outgoing Maximum 
Bandwidth and Incoming Maximum Bandwidth preferences in Administrator Preferences : Calls
The value that you choose for the Outgoing Maximum Bandwidth becomes the maximum value that users can choose in 
the user interface when placing a call by dialing a number manually or when specifying a bandwidth in a directory entry. 
If a user specifies Auto for the bandwidth when placing a call, the maximum outgoing bandwidth becomes the starting 
point for negotiating bandwidth when the call connects.
If you choose Auto as the value for the Outgoing Maximum Bandwidth and Incoming Maximum Bandwidth preferences and 
the user chooses Auto for the bandwidth when placing the call, the system places the call at 1152 kb/s.
The Auto Bandwidth preference addresses how the system responds to packet loss during a call. 
When set to Enabled, the system attempts to use the best available bandwidth after the call connects.
Selecting a Maximum Call Time
You can control the amount of time that a call stays connected by selecting an option for the Maximum Call Time preference 
in Administrator Preferences : Calls.

Auto Answer Options
You can configure your system to automatically answer incoming calls by setting preferences in User Preferences : Calls or 
Administrator Preferences : Calls menu as follows:
•  Auto Answer: If it is set to Enabled, the system automatically answers the first incoming call. If it is set to Disabled (the 
default), you must manually answer incoming calls.
